Minor Fire at Red River Range Shooting Facility Quickly Contained in Shreveport

Shreveport, LA – A minor fire erupted at the Red River Range shooting range on Sunday afternoon when a round fired by a patron struck an installation inside a wall, sending sparks that ignited nearby material. The incident was reported to the Shreveport Fire Department, which responded promptly and confirmed that the blaze was quickly contained.

Quick Response Keeps Everyone Safe

According to an employee at the range, the round hit a metal fixture embedded in the wall, producing a burst of sparks that ignited a small flame. “We saw the sparks and immediately pulled the range’s fire suppression system into action,” the employee said. Firefighters arrived within minutes, assessed the situation, and determined that the fire posed no threat to patrons or staff.

No Injuries, Business Reopens

Fortunately, no one was injured during the incident. The Shreveport Fire Department issued a brief statement confirming that the fire was minor and that all safety protocols were followed. After the fire was extinguished and the area inspected, Red River Range was able to reopen for business later that afternoon, allowing shooters and families to resume their activities.
